Methyl (Z)-oct-4-enoate, also known as methyl (4Z)-oct-4-enoate, is an organic compound that belongs to the class of esters. It is characterized by the presence of a carbon-carbon double bond in the Z configuration, which gives it unique chemical and physical properties. methyl (Z)-oct-4-enoate can be synthesized from cis-4-octenoic acid ethyl ester and methanol in the presence of a sodium catalyst. Methyl (Z)-oct-4-enoate is known for its distinct chemical structure and potential applications in various industries.

21063-71-8 Usage

Uses

Used in Flavor and Fragrance Industry:
Methyl (Z)-oct-4-enoate is used as a flavoring agent for its fruity and tropical aroma. It is commonly employed in the creation of artificial fruit flavors, particularly those mimicking the taste of pineapple, starfruit, and pawpaw. The compound's unique scent profile makes it a valuable addition to the flavor and fragrance industry.
Used in Chemical Synthesis:
Methyl (Z)-oct-4-enoate serves as a versatile building block in organic synthesis, allowing for the development of various chemical compounds with diverse applications. Its carbon-carbon double bond can be selectively functionalized, making it a useful intermediate in the synthesis of p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als, and other specialty chemicals.
Used in Research and Development:
Due to its unique chemical structure, methyl (Z)-oct-4-enoate is often utilized in research and development for studying various chemical reactions and processes. It can be employed as a model compound to investigate the reactivity of carbon-carbon double bonds, as well as to explore new synthetic routes and methodologies.
Used in Analytical Chemistry:
Methyl (Z)-oct-4-enoate can be used as a reference compound in analytical chemistry for the calibration of instruments and the development of new analytical methods. Its distinct chemical properties make it suitable for testing the performance of chromatographic techniques, spectroscopic methods, and other analytical tools.

Preparation

From cis-4-octenoic acid ethyl ester and methanol in the presence of sodium catalyst.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 21063-71-8 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 2,1,0,6 and 3 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 7 and 1 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 21063-71:
(7*2)+(6*1)+(5*0)+(4*6)+(3*3)+(2*7)+(1*1)=68
68 % 10 = 8
So 21063-71-8 is a valid CAS Registry Number.
